Lakers Sweep at Monroe Community College POD

Lakers Sweep at Monroe Community College POD

CANANDAIGUA, N.Y. – The Finger Lakes Community College women's volleyball improved their record to 7-6 on the season and extended their winning streak to 5 at the Monroe Community College POD.

Lakers vs. SUNY Adirondack

The Lakers picked up a 3-0 sweep over SUNY Adirondack, taking sets 1-3, 25-11, 25-9, and 25-13. Freshman Megan Sanford (Campbell, N.Y./ Campbell-Savona) helped lead the Lakers to the win with 7 kills and 1 block solo. Teammate Brooke DeGroff (Castile, N.Y./ Letchworth) followed with an impressive performance of her own, with 10 kills and 4 digs.

Sophomore Meghan Johnson (Phelps, N.Y./ Newark) put together one of her best performances of the season, adding in 7 ills, 2 aces, and 7 digs in the match. Freshman teammates Sage Barnedo (Silver Springs, M.D./ Springbrook) and Adrianna Botello (Holley, N.Y./ Holley) helped set up their teammates, with Botello adding 12 assists and 6 digs, while Barnedo added 11 assists, 5 aces, and 8 digs.

Freshman Olivia Sheehan (Irondequoit, N.Y./ West Irondequoit) helped guide the team to victory, tallying 2 assists, 4 aces, and 10 digs.

 Lakers vs. Genesee Community College

The Lakers followed up their sweep against SUNY Adirondack with another one against the Cougars of Genesee Community College. The team continued their dominance, finishing sets 1-3, 25-12, 25-15, and 25-11.

Brooke DeGroff and Olivia Sheehan followed up impressive performances, with DeGroff tallying 14 points with 11 kills, 3 aces, and 17 digs. Sheehan would follow with 3 aces and 19 digs, good for 3 points.

Kierstin Comerford (Geneva, N.Y./ Geneva) and Kaidyn VanDelinder (Gananda, N.Y./ Gananda) would each play all three sets. Comerford would add 1 ace and 3 digs, while VanDelinder would tally 3 kills. Sophomores Kayla Fetcie (Victor, N.Y./ Victor) and Meghan Johnson helped lead the team. Fetcie added 5 kills, 2 aces, and 5 digs, while Johnson contributed 6 kills and 15 digs.

Lakers vs. Hudson Valley Community College

The Lakers found their greatest opposition against the Vikings of Hudson Valley Community College. Despite a dominant first set victory of 25-5, the Lakers would take set two by a narrow score of 25-19. The Vikings would battle back to take set three 26-24, before the Lakers finished the game in the fourth set, 25-10.

Freshman Megan Sanford put together her most impressive performance of the season with 11 kills, 1 block solo, and 2 block assists. Teammate Kaidyn VanDelinder would put together one of her best games as well, tallying 9 kills, 2 digs, and 3 block assists. Freshman Brooke DeGroff continued her consistent offensive production with 9 kills, 3 aces, 16 digs, and 1 block assist. 

The Lakers will ride a 5 game win streak into a home matchup with the Cayuga Community College Spartans on September 14th at 6 PM at Finger Lakes Community College.
